Preparation for connection: what to check before pairing

Before you start connecting, make sure your smartphone and watch meet the minimum requirements. Mi Band 5 is compatible with Android 5.0+ or iOS 10.0+ devices, but more recent OS versions are recommended for full operation.

  • πŸ”‹ The battery charge of the watch is at least 20%. At low charge, the pairing process can be interrupted.
  • πŸ“Ά Bluetooth on your phone – must be enabled and in device search mode.
  • πŸ“± Application permissions – Mi Fit or Zepp Life must have access to geodata, notifications, and contacts (for proper functionality).
  • πŸ”„ Firmware updates – if the watch has not been updated for a long time, you may need to update it through official software.

Pay special attention to the region of the account. Xiaomi links the functionality of the devices to the country of registration of the Mi Account. For example, in the Chinese version of the firmware may not be Russian, and in the European version some features (such as measuring blood oxygen levels) If you bought a watch in China, you may need to change the region of the account.

Method 1: Connect via the official Mi Fit app

Despite Xiaomi’s move to Zepp Life, Mi Fit remains relevant for many users, especially owners of older versions of the watch. To connect the Mi Band 5 via Mi Fit, follow the following steps:

  1. Download and install Mi Fit from Google Play or the App Store. Make sure the app version is no older than 2023 - legacy versions may not support new firmware.
  2. Sign up or sign in to your Mi Account. If you don't have an account, create it through the app or at account.xiaomi.com.
  3. Turn on the Mi Band 5 by touching the touch button. The watch should vibrate and display the Mi logo.
  4. In the Mi Fit app, go to Profile β†’ Add Device and select Mi Smart Band 5.
  5. Follow the instructions on the screen: confirm the pairing on the clock (touch the tick) and wait for the synchronization to complete.

If the process is stuck in the β€œConnection” stage, try:

  • πŸ”„ Reboot Bluetooth on your phone (disable/enable in settings).
  • πŸ“± Remove the watch from the list of associated devices in the Bluetooth settings of the phone and try again.
  • πŸ”‹ Remove the charging cable from the watch for 10 seconds and insert it back (soft reset).

Method 2: Connect via Zepp Life (formerly Amazfit)

From 2023, Xiaomi recommends using Zepp Life to manage the Mi Band 5.This app offers advanced health analytics and a more modern interface, but may not support some of the features of older firmware.

  1. Install Zepp Life from Google Play or App Store.
  2. Sign in through your Mi Account (if you already have a Zepp account, use it).
  3. In the main menu of the app, click Add Device and select Mi Smart Band 5.
  4. Allow the app to access notifications, geodata, and physical activity (required for the tracker to work properly).
  5. Hold the phone to the clock (not more than 10 cm) and wait for the vibration on the bracelet. Confirm the pairing by pressing the touch button.

Important: If you have previously used Mi Fit, you need to untie the watch from the old app before connecting to Zepp Life. To do this, go to Profile β†’ Mi Smart Band 5 β†’ Untie the device. Otherwise, there may be a connection conflict.

Solving common connection errors

Even when following the instructions, users often encounter errors, and consider the most common problems and ways to fix them:

Mistake.Possible causeDecision
"Can't find the device."Bluetooth is off or the clock is deadTurn on Bluetooth, charge your watch to 50%, reboot your phone
"Device not supported"An outdated version of the app or firmware watchUpdate Mi Fit/Zepp Life and watch firmware through settings
"Sync error"Conflict with another associated deviceRemove the watch from the phone’s Bluetooth device list and reconnect
"The Wrong Region"Mi Account is linked to another region (e.g. China)Change your account region in settings or create a new account

If the clock is connected but the data is not synchronized (steps, pulse, sleep), try:

  • πŸ”„ Reconnect the device in the application (Profile) β†’ Mi Smart Band 5 β†’ Untie. β†’ Reconnect).
  • πŸ“± Clear the Mi app cache Fit/Zepp Life in the phone settings.
  • πŸ”‹ Reset the clock to factory settings (press the touch button 10 seconds before vibration).
What if the watch doesn’t vibrate when connected?
If the Mi Band 5 does not respond to touch and does not vibrate, this may indicate: 1. Battery discharge below 5% (plug in to charge for 30 minutes). 2. Firmware freeze (remove the charging cable, wait 1 minute, insert back in). 3. Mechanical breakage of the touch button (check the charging reaction - if the indicator is on, but no vibration, contact the service).

Setting up hours after connecting: what to do first

After successful pairing, it is recommended to perform the basic setting of the Mi Band 5 for comfortable use:

  1. Update firmware: Go to Profile β†’ Mi Smart Band 5 β†’ Update firmware. Current version for 2026 is 1.0.9.54 (may vary depending on the region). Update takes 5-10 minutes, do not interrupt the process!
  2. Set up notifications: In Device Settings β†’ Notifications, select apps that must duplicate the alerts on the clock. Android also requires you to allow Mi Fit/Zepp Life to access notifications in your system settings.
  3. Activate health monitoring: Enable continuous pulse measurement (Settings β†’ Heart Rate Monitor β†’ Continuous) and blood oxygen levels (SpO2). These features shorten battery life, but are useful for monitoring the condition.
  4. Set the dial: In Profile β†’ Mi Smart Band 5 β†’ Dials, select one of the pre-installed options or download additional ones from the store (available only in Zepp Life).

Frequent questions and problems after connecting

Even after successful pairing, users are faced with nuances in the work of the Mi Band 5.

❓ Why the clock doesn't show call notifications?
The problem may be related to: Lack of permissions for Mi Fit/Zepp Life (check notification settings on your phone); power saving restrictions (add the app to exceptions in battery settings); incompatibility with some messengers (e.g. Viber requires separate permission); Solution: reconnect the clock and reboot the phone.
❓ How to Reset Mi Band 5 to Factory Settings?
Follow the following steps: Open the Mi Fit or Zepp Life app. Go to Profile β†’ Mi Smart Band 5 β†’ Untie the device. On the watch itself, press the touch button 10 to 15 seconds before the vibration. Reconnect the watch as a new device. ⚠️ Warning: Reset deletes all data from the clock (steps, sleep history) if it wasn't synced with the app.
❓ Can you connect Mi Band 5 to two phones at the same time?
Officially, no. The watch only pairs with one device. But there's a workaround: Connect the watch to the first phone and sync the data. Untie it in the app, but don't reset it. Connect it to the second phone. Steps and pulse data will be duplicated, but notifications will only be on the last device connected. To work properly with the two phones, you'll need to constantly reconnect the clock.
❓ Why the clock is discharged quickly?
Main causes: πŸ”‹ Continuous monitoring of the pulse and SpO2 (turn off in the settings). πŸ“Ά Constant sync with the phone (increase the interval in the application settings). 🌑️ Low temperature (in the cold, the battery goes down faster). πŸ”„ Outdated firmware (update via app) Normal lifetime on a single charge is 7-14 days with moderate use.
